Forensic Challenges In Cross-Border Dna Evidence Collection Involving Chinese Authorities
1. The Liu Case (Cross-Border Murder Investigation, 2016)
Facts: Liu, a Chinese national, was suspected of committing a homicide in Southeast Asia and then returning to China. The foreign authorities requested DNA evidence from China to confirm his presence at the crime scene abroad.
Challenges: China required a formal mutual legal assistance request. Foreign investigators could not directly collect DNA; the process had to go through the Ministry of Justice and the local procuratorate.
Outcome: DNA was collected under Chinese supervision, but the process took over 8 months, leading to evidence degradation concerns. Eventually, the DNA profile matched the foreign crime scene, but the delay meant other circumstantial evidence had weakened.
Significance: Highlights the delay and procedural bottlenecks inherent in cross-border forensic cooperation with China.
2. The Zhang Telecom Fraud DNA Investigation (2018)
Facts: A telecom fraud ring operated between China and Europe. Chinese authorities identified suspects and needed to link DNA evidence from phones and personal items seized abroad to suspects in China.
Challenges: European authorities collected DNA from items, but China initially refused to admit the evidence due to differences in forensic methodology and chain-of-custody concerns.
Outcome: A joint forensic team, including Chinese experts, validated the samples according to Chinese forensic standards. The evidence was admitted in the trial, leading to convictions.
Significance: Shows that different forensic standards can delay admissibility and require harmonization.
3. The Xinjiang Population DNA Controversy (2017)
Facts: Reports indicated mass DNA collection from Uyghur populations in Xinjiang. Some international human rights organizations requested cross-border verification to investigate alleged abuses.
Challenges: Chinese authorities refused to release DNA samples citing national security and privacy, illustrating that even forensic evidence in human rights investigations faces sovereignty restrictions.
Outcome: No DNA was provided to foreign investigators. The case demonstrates limitations of international cooperation when state security is invoked.
Significance: Highlights that cross-border DNA evidence collection is not only technical but also political and legal.
4. The Wu Cybercrime and DNA Tracing Case (2019)
Facts: Wu, a Chinese national, was suspected of online sexual extortion in collaboration with overseas actors. Law enforcement needed to verify DNA from physical devices shipped abroad.
Challenges: DNA collection from seized devices overseas required formal requests, and foreign labs had to follow Chinese chain-of-custody requirements.
Outcome: The DNA samples were eventually collected, verified, and used to link Wu to the crimes. Delays of several months affected the timing of arrests.
Significance: Demonstrates how cybercrime investigations intersect with DNA forensics and the importance of coordinated procedures.
5. The International Drug Trafficking DNA Case (2020)
Facts: Chinese authorities were investigating a trafficking ring connected to Latin America. Foreign authorities provided DNA from drugs-handling locations to link suspects.
Challenges: China insisted on formal MLA requests and verified the lab processes before accepting DNA evidence. Differences in forensic certification standards caused additional delays.
Outcome: DNA helped establish connections, but the slow process underscored how cross-border collection is vulnerable to time decay and evidentiary loss.
Significance: Shows that DNA evidence is valuable but highly sensitive to procedural and institutional delays.
6. The International Child Exploitation DNA Collaboration (2021)
Facts: A Chinese citizen was implicated in an international child exploitation network. Foreign authorities collected DNA from seized devices and sought to confirm identity via Chinese forensic labs.
Challenges: Chinese authorities required that samples be processed domestically under supervision. There were also concerns about personal data protection.
Outcome: DNA matched the suspect; he was prosecuted in China. The process highlighted privacy laws intersecting with forensic cooperation.
Significance: Illustrates that privacy protections and national data laws can complicate cross-border DNA investigations.
7. The Belt & Road Initiative Cross-Border Fraud Case (2022)
Facts: Fraud involving multiple BRI countries required verification of suspect identity via DNA collected in China and shared with foreign authorities.
Challenges: Different DNA testing standards and procedural requirements led to initial rejections of foreign samples.
Outcome: A collaborative forensic task force harmonized methodology, allowing evidence to be admitted in court.
Significance: Shows that harmonized forensic standards are essential for admissibility in cross-border prosecutions.
Key Takeaways from These Cases
Mutual Legal Assistance (MLA) is essential: Direct DNA collection by foreign authorities is prohibited.
Delays are common: DNA degradation and loss of other evidence can occur.
Differences in forensic standards: DNA admissibility requires harmonization between jurisdictions.
National security & privacy: China may refuse evidence requests citing these concerns.
Collaborative forensic teams: Often necessary for cross-border DNA evidence to be valid in court.
